DIY IN GRAZIA!
29th October 2012
Grazia recently asked me to style two of my favourite looks from my new book for a spread in their magazine. The ensemble I put together is typical of the projects in the book – simple, timeless and able to be seamlessly worked into just about anyone’s wardrobe. While creating the new projects for my book, I focused on pieces that wouldn’t date too easily and could be integrated into an adaptable and chic wardrobe – I knew that for trend items hot off the runway you could come here to my blog, and so for my book I chose pieces that would stand the test of time.
The chain collar top and feather hem skirt are both simple updates to secondhand items that take them from basic to being the sorts of pieces I’ve worn time and time again. Make sure you grab a copy of Grazia Australia this week to read an exclusive extract of a tutorial from the book!
